Transaction c26891abcab48c1779698176a1129defacafd614249e3b61ae709849ad0e50cb
1 Input
1 Output
-
c26891abcab48c1779698176a1129defacafd614249e3b61ae709849ad0e50cb:0
- value
- 602686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b01f28b2defe07489c61fb8d06a69826242ce85 OP_EQUAL
- address
- 3QaDs19nivfMMaEzwYoacf1HfjJcfeZraU